The Relationship between Sleep and Mood

Introduction

Sleep is essential for both physical and mental health. When we don't get enough sleep, it can have a negative impact on our mood, making us feel more irritable, stressed, and anxious. It can also make it difficult to concentrate and think clearly. There are several reasons why sleep is so important for mood. First, sleep helps to regulate our emotions. When we sleep, our brains produce and process hormones and neurotransmitters that are involved in mood regulation. For example, the hormone serotonin, which is often referred to as the "happy hormone," is produced during sleep. Second, sleep helps to consolidate memories and process emotions. When we sleep, our brains replay and process the events of the day. This helps us to make sense of our experiences and to learn from them. It also helps us to cope with negative emotions and to develop positive emotional regulation skills. Third, sleep helps to reduce inflammation throughout the body. Inflammation is thought to play a role in several mental health disorders, including depression and anxiety. When we don't get enough sleep, our bodies produce more inflammatory chemicals. This can lead to increased inflammation throughout the body, which can worsen mood symptoms. Research has shown that there is a strong link between sleep deprivation and mood disorders. For example, people with depression and anxiety are more likely to experience sleep problems. And people who don't get enough sleep are more likely to develop depression and anxiety.
